"I'm Photosynthesizing" consists of a thrifted painting of flowers in a field, pool noodles, cupboard liner, yarn, string, reusable bags, and acrylic paint. Like the flowers in the original painting – although ripped, shredded, and painted over – I like to imagine I am photosynthesizing. Often during times of struggle, especially when I am struggling with my mental health, I remind myself to stop and soak up the sun’s healing energy. Sometimes I tell my friends, “Let’s go photosynthesize today.” It is a reminder for me to give myself the care that I need and deserve. Like all my artworks where I utilize found objects or “trash,” I hope to inspire people to see their darkness as a source of strength. I want to challenge what we define as “trash” and see the potential in materials and ourselves, especially in this disposable consumerist system.
Where it's been: 2024: TOAF63 (Toronto Outdoor Art Fair), Fix Up Look Sharp (Northern Contemporary Gallery). 2023: Nuit Blanche (Blitz Art Gallery).
